Understanding Age-Related Hearing Loss (Presbycusis)

Presbycusis is the most common form of hearing loss among older adults, caused by progressive wear on the cochlea and auditory nerve. Higher-frequency sounds become hard to perceive first, making speech-heavy dialogue (such as “s,” “th,” or “f”) especially difficult to comprehend. Gradually, this leads to frequent asks for repeating, misheard instructions, and mounting avoidance to engage in conversations with multiple people. The NIDCD reports that almost roughly one-third people aged 65–74 and nearly half of those 75 and older face disabling hearing loss. Prompt, steady support prevents these changes from worsening into more profound social and emotional effects.

Why Communication Breaks Down at Home

Home environments offer distinct obstacles: reverberating hallways, interfering sounds from living areas or televisions, and inconsistent illumination that obscures lip-reading cues. Seniors may fail to notice how much they unconsciously depend on body language to enhance hearing. When these helps are absent or unsteady, even everyday interactions feel draining, contributing to shorter conversations and reduced participation.

What Are Effective Communication Strategies for Hearing Loss at Home?

Practical techniques for clearer home conversations with hearing challenges focus on establishing environments where dialogue is received effectively and comfortably. Assistants teach these techniques gradually, assisting seniors and families create habits that decrease strain and increase mutual comprehension.

Face-to-Face Techniques and Visual Cues

Face-to-face face viewing and open sight of the person speaking help clarity. Hand movements reinforce verbal messages. These basics create the core of smooth exchange, making interactions more natural.

Positioning and Lighting Tips

Arrange seating so expressions are brightly visible without dark areas or glare. Ambient window light or flexible lamps support lip-reading. Steer clear of reverse lighting that darkens speakers, ensuring good view supports comprehension.

Clear Speech Without Shouting

Talk at a normal level but with careful articulation. Slow your tempo a bit and stop between phrases. Loud speaking distorts audio and can seem disrespectful—distinctness at natural volume performs far superior.

Reducing Background Noise for Better Clarity

Turn off interfering sources during key talks. Close openings to prevent hallway sounds. Choosing more peaceful rooms for dining or visits dramatically improves speech intelligibility.

Home Environment Adjustments

Place carpets or cushions in resonant zones to reduce echo. Rearrange furniture so talk areas are separated from noisy hallways. Simple audio tweaks yield outsized benefits.

Using Gestures and Written Aids

Easy gestures clarify important terms. Maintain a notepad or clearly written notes nearby for numbers. These non-electronic assists supply consistent backups when verbal clarity struggles.

Technology-Free Tools That Work

Clear written notes or picture cards deliver details. They give quick, efficient help excluding requiring technical equipment that may confuse.

Daily Practice Routines for Consistency

Allocate short periods every day for focused dialogue rehearsal. Recap the day’s activities, relate a memory, or share reading as a group. Regular practice strengthens both skill and assurance.

Addressing Missed Auditory Cues

Seniors commonly overlook common audio signals that indicate potential danger—entry chimes, kitchen alerts, fire alarms, or a loved one shouting from elsewhere. Support providers add visual or tactile alternatives that make up for efficiently.

Door Bells, Smoke Alarms, and Emergency Calls

Install light signals for visitor signals and alarms, or apply tactile alerts for phone calls. Caregivers teach proper responses, developing muscle memory for quick, confident action.

Fall Prevention Through Awareness

Hearing loss often co-occurs with equilibrium issues. Assistants reinforce environmental scanning—looking prior to stepping—and pair auditory limitations with visual safety checks to lower accident likelihood.

Integrating Wellness Checks and Mobility Support

Regular visits enable caregivers to spot developing risks—messy areas, poor lighting, loose rugs—and address them preventively. Mobility assistance ensures stable and confident movement around the house.

Daily Safety Monitoring

Caregivers monitor routines and identify changes—such as slower response times or pausing in particular spaces—then adapt assistance programs appropriately to ensure protection.

Home Modification Ideas Without Major Changes

Simple changes like better light, visible markings on steps, or identified buttons offer eyesight-based support. These low-cost adjustments substantially boost mobility and lower accident likelihood.
